We have been eating Audrey's chocolates for over 40 years. We have also done a lot of "market research" elsewhere - in England and Europe. No-one beats Audrey's yet. We only go for dark chocolates. Their griottes (formerly named cerisettes) are cherries soaked in brandy and then covered in their divine dark chocolate. They arrive nestled in a wooden box. They make the best possible gifts for closest friends and family - (but be sure to order in the summer ready for Christmas). We love that the shop remains its old fashioned lovely self - it is like stepping back into another elegant era and the staff are unfailingly kind, helpful and patient. Long may it continue - basically unchanging and producing the best ever chocolates. PS Pleased to say we have passed on our passion for Audreys to the next generation.

Audrey’s Chocolates, the oldest chocolatier in Sussex, has been delighting chocolate lovers with its handcrafted creations since 1948. Known for its artisanal chocolates, this family-run business has become a symbol of quality and craftsmanship, attracting customers from across Sussex and beyond.
